Between the Walls
by Dennis Henderson
There are places we leave behind.Apartments. Houses. Rooms we stop thinking about. We assume they remain the way we left them—quiet, empty, unchanged.But sometimes… something remains.Between the Walls is a cinematic, confessional audio series exploring the spaces where reality doesn’t behave the way it should. Each episode presents a contained account: a single location, a small group of witnesses, and the subtle unraveling of something that doesn’t fully make sense.There are no jump scares. No dramatized performances. Only memory, atmosphere, and the quiet tension of what almost feels explainable.Told with restraint and precision, these stories sit at the intersection of psychological horror and lived experience—where the most unsettling moments are the ones that feel just within reach of logic.Because sometimes the question isn’t what haunts us.It’s what a place remembers.

Three Knocks
Four college roommates begin experiencing something they can’t explain—individually.A smell of smoke with no source. Footsteps in an empty hallway. A voice that doesn’t belong.Each of them dismisses it. Stress. Exhaustion. Imagination.Until one night, they all hear it at the same time.Three knocks.What follows is not a ghost story in the traditional sense, but a shared encounter that forces them to confront something far more unsettling: a presence that doesn’t just linger… but waits.As they begin to piece together what happened in the house before they arrived, a pattern emerges—one tied to a fire, a child, and a hallway that was never fully left behind.Told in a restrained, confessional style, Three Knocks explores what happens when a space holds onto the last moment it was needed most.
